Wu-she Dam
Wushe Dam is a gravity dam forming Wushe Reservoir, also called Wanda Reservoir and Bihu, on the Wushe Creek, a tributary of the Zhuoshui River, located in Ren-ai Township, Nantou County, Taiwan.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.

Ch’ing-ching Farm
Village
Photo: extremestim,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Qingjing Farm, also known as Cingjing Farm, is a tourist attraction farm in Ren'ai Township, Nantou County, Taiwan. Located at an altitude of 1,700 ~2,000 meters, it's known as one of the three major high mountain farms in Taiwan, besides Wuling Farm and Fushoushan Farm. Ch’ing-ching Farm is situated 9 km north of Wu-she Dam.
